61 Queensway, Burton Latimer, Kettering, NN15 5QH is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 829 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£243,171 , which equates to approximately £293 per square foot. It was last sold on 21 Mar 2016 for £152,100. Since then, the value has increased by £91,071, representing a 59.9% increase, or approximately 6.1% per year.

The current estimated value of £243,171 is:

  • 5.7% lower than the average property price on Queensway
  • 3.9% lower than the average in the NN15 5QH postcode area
  • and 10.2% lower than the average price for Kettering as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 8 December 2015,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

61 Queensway, Burton Latimer, Kettering, Northamptonshire, NN15 5QH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 8 Jan 2016.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 8 Dec 2015. The rating of E is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 6%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 270 mm loft insulation to pitched, 250 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The windows were upgraded from mostly double glazing to fully double glazed.
